ESET Asia Pte. Ltd., a global leader in cybersecurity, and Canon Singapore Pte. Ltd. have announced an extension of their strategic partnership through a new Memorandum of Understanding (MOU). This agreement will see ESET’s award-winning cybersecurity solutions progressively integrated into Canon’s digital portfolio, targeting businesses and enterprises across Asia.
Canon has already been offering ESET’s cybersecurity solutions in key markets such as Japan, India, and Singapore. This MOU represents the next phase in strengthening and broadening their partnership, aligning with Canon’s strategic shift beyond imaging hardware to provide comprehensive solutions that help businesses transform and future-proof their operations.
Parvinder Walia, President of the Asia Pacific Region, ESET, emphasised the importance of cybersecurity, stating, “Cybersecurity is no longer optional. It’s foundational to any business, big or small.” He added that Canon’s decision to extend endpoint protection to its customers is timely and reflects a keen understanding of today’s digital landscape.
Fukui Shinsuke, Senior Director of Regional Business Imaging Solutions at Canon Singapore, highlighted the collaboration’s goal to provide trusted solutions for customers. “With this integration, Canon will be well-equipped to meet the growing office security needs of modern enterprises, which includes SMEs and large enterprises,” he said.
